Why Temperature Matters
Breast Milk isn’t just food for your baby, it’s living, liquid gold! It’s not only packed with amazing ingredients like lactoferrin, enzymes, and antibodies that help your baby grow healthy and strong while building up their little immune system — but those powerful nutrients are also extremely delicate.
They are sensitive to high temperatures and can easily break down if the milk gets too hot. According to the Centers for Disease Control and Prevention (CDC), breast milk should never be microwaved or overheated. Instead, the CDC recommends warming breast milk by placing the bottle or a milk storage bag in warm water, avoiding direct heat, or using a reliable bottle warmer.
Studies have shown that warming breast milk above 104°F (40°C) can begin to destroy sensitive proteins and enzymes. Heating breast milk beyond 122°F (50°C) can break down incredibly important immune factors like secretory IgA and lactoferrin, both of which play a huge role in protecting your baby from illnesses.
Most experts, including the CDC and ABM, advise warming milk to around 98.6°F / 37°C to keep the breast milk safe for your baby's consumption while also protecting its amazing nutrients.

What to Look for in a Bottle Warmer
Here are some important factors to keep in mind when choosing a bottle warmer:
Gentle Warming: Protecting your precious milk’s nutrients, as mentioned previously, is important. Choosing a warmer that won't heat above 104°F ensures it stays safe for your baby.
Even Heating: Choose a bottle warmer that maintains a consistent temperature throughout the bottle, to avoid hot spots that could harm your baby.
Efficient Warming Time: A warmer that heats up in an appropriate amount of time is important, especially for parents of multiples.
Bottle Compatibility: A bottle warmer that is versatile enough to handle different types of bottles is also important, as we never know what kind of bottle the baby will prefer.
Ease of Use: Let's face it — no one likes to read instructions. A bottle warmer that is easy to use and understand is elite.
